You can use the windows help feature and click on "index" and search for sticky keys. It will tell you how to turn them on and off. Here is the clip.


To turn on StickyKeys

Open Accessibility Options in Control Panel.
On the Keyboard tab, under StickyKeys, select the Use StickyKeys check box.
Notes

To open Accessibility Options, click Start, point to Settings, click Control Panel, and then double-click Accessibility Options.
To change settings for StickyKeys, on the Keyboard tab, under StickyKeys, click Settings.

Hit the Shift key repeatedly till the sticky keys config pops up. Click each settings button and uncheck use shortcuts for each individual item. That should at least stop you getting stupid warning messages during games and what not
